This review is for Amici's Italian Restaurant, South Brisbane QLD

verified email - 29 Oct 2010

Situated near the pool at Southbank, this restaurant has a lovely outdoor dining area surrounded by lush vegetation. Which is also the home to some very large lace monitor lizards (i think that's what kind they are) that often come out and walk around the tables looking for food!!! At which time legs go up on chairs and the odd unsuspecting dinner lets out a scream! The staff come over and guide the lizards back towards the bushes....basically you get dinner and a show! We've been 3 time and the food has been good, we've tried pizza (Amici's special with chili), Pasta (cabonara) and the Lasagna and enjoyed it all. The coffee is good too. Prices are standard, they are in the entertainment book if you have one and you'll get 25% off.
